Services That Come to You
You might be surprised just how many repairs and services can be handled on-site. Some of the most common include:
- Oil changes and fluid checks
- Brake inspections and replacements
- Engine diagnostics and repairs
- Battery replacement
- Radiator and cooling system services
- Starter and alternator issues
- AC repairs and recharges (a must in the San Diego heat)
- Transmission issues
- Pre-purchase vehicle inspections
- RV repairs and maintenance
- Volkswagen-specific diagnostics and mods
The mobile units aren’t just a mechanic with a toolbox. These are fully stocked service vans equipped to handle everything from basic maintenance to more complex repairs.
